General Educational Leadership & Administration is the 33rd most popular major in the country with 32,654 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across Maryland, there were 460 general educational leadership and administration gra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 53 general educational leadership and administration graduates with average earnings and debt of $76,340 and $104,765 respectively.

Top 3 Best Value Doctor’s Degree Colleges for General Educational Leadership & Administration in Maryland (With Aid)

#1

University of Maryland - College Park

College Park, Maryland
#1 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Maryland - College Park.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Educational Leadership and Administration Schools for a Doctorate in Maryland For Those Getting Aid list. University of Maryland - College Park is located in College Park, Maryland and, has a large student population. In 2019-2020, this school awarded 28 doctorate’s educational leadership and administration degrees to qualified students.

UMCP also took the #1 spot in our “Best General Educational Leadership & Administration Doctor’s Degree Schools in Maryland” ranking.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at University of Maryland - College Park are $30,885.

#2

Frostburg State University

Frostburg, Maryland
#3 in overall quality

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Educational Leadership and Administration Schools for a Doctorate in Maryland For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, Frostburg State University landed the #2 spot on the list. This small school is located in Frostburg, Maryland, and it awarded 11 doctorate’s educational leadership and administration degrees in 2019-2020.

Frostburg State did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#3 on our “Best General Educational Leadership & Administration Doctor’s Degree Schools in Maryland” list.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at Frostburg State are $12,790.

#3

Morgan State University

Baltimore, Maryland
#2 in overall quality

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Educational Leadership and Administration Schools for a Doctorate in Maryland For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, Morgan State University landed the #3 spot on the list. Morgan State is located in Baltimore, Maryland and, has a medium-sized student population. In 2019-2020, this school awarded 10 doctorate’s educational leadership and administration degrees to qualified students.

Morgan State also took the #2 spot in our “Best General Educational Leadership & Administration Doctor’s Degree Schools in Maryland” ranking.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at Morgan State are $17,339.
